The answer is given below :

The answer can be found easily by finding the square values as followed -

 {1}^{2}  = 1 \\  \\  {2}^{2}  = 4 \\  \\  {3}^{2}  = 9 \\  \\  {4}^{2}  = 16 \\  \\  {5}^{2}  = 25 \\  \\  {6}^{2}  = 36 \\  \\  {7}^{2}  = 49 \\  \\  {8}^{2}  = 64 \\  \\  {9}^{2}  = 81 \\  \\  {10}^{2}  = 100

So, it can be concluded easily that 81 is the required perfect square in two digits.
